Zoho One is the default all-in-one for Indian SMBs, and for good reason. This page sets out where KaryaFlow is genuinely different, where Zoho is genuinely ahead, and every figure's source. Checked 8 August 2026.
We would rather you read this than discover it after signing. Choose Zoho One if you need finance, inventory, or payroll modules today — KaryaFlow does not ship those. Choose it if nearly everyone on your payroll needs a licence anyway, because the all-employee rate is then genuinely hard to beat. And choose it if vendor maturity matters more to you than architecture: KaryaFlow was founded in 2026 and is in private preview, with no published customer base. Those are real reasons, and no comparison table changes them.

Zoho One has two pricing models, and the difference between them matters more than the headline rate. Under All Employee Pricing, Zoho's own FAQ states it “requires you to buy licenses for every employee in your company”. If you fall short, Zoho says it will “notify you to either purchase remaining licenses or switch to Flexible User Pricing”.
So the cheaper number is conditional. It applies when you cover everyone on payroll — including the people who will never open the software. The alternative, Flexible User Pricing, lets you licence only who needs it at US$90 per user per month with annual licensing.
That is the comparison that matters for a 40-person company where 15 people need the tool. KaryaFlow charges US$20 or US$99 per user per month and you licence those 15. Run your own numbers both ways before you take anyone's word for it, ours included.
On rupee pricing: we have deliberately not published INR figures for Zoho One. Their pricing page renders in USD for us, and the rupee numbers circulating online appear only on third-party sites. Ask Zoho for a current INR quote — and note that Indian invoices attract GST on top of the listed rate.
Zoho One is 45+ applications organised into 11 categories. That breadth is real, and it is the main reason to buy it — finance, inventory, payroll, legal, and IT management are all in the box. KaryaFlow does not match that surface area and will not pretend to.
The difference is what sits underneath. KaryaFlow was built on one shared data model: the customer record your sales team edits is the same row your support team and your AI agents read. There is no sync, because there is no second copy.
The question to put to any all-in-one vendor is simple: when two applications disagree about a customer, which one is right, and what reconciles them? Ask it of us too.
Zoho markets Zia Agents as “purpose-built AI agents to support your specific business processes”. We are not going to tell you they don't have agents — they do, and anyone claiming otherwise is working from stale information.
The question that actually matters once an agent can write to your records is governance, and here the public documentation differs. Zoho's Zia page does not describe approval workflows, human-in-the-loop gates, or an audit log of AI actions. KaryaFlow logs every agent action to an immutable trail and lets you put approval gates on anything that changes data.
Absence from a marketing page is not proof of absence from a product. So make both vendors demonstrate it live: show me the log of what the agent did last week, and show me how I stop it doing something I haven't approved.
